I have a home made, light proof aeroponic system with 3 plants. I am about 2 months into the life cycle. Ionic is the name of the nutrient solution. The resevoir is 10 gallons. 1 Airstone. 18-6 light cycle. Water pump is on for 15 min/off for 30 min...for both day and night. Around 70 degrees F. Florescent lighting.

I have been dealing with what I think is root rot because the leaves are starting to form little rusty spots and then eventually turning yellow and dying. I got a solution to rectify the root rot but it seems like the plants are still developing the spots.

Any other problems (with similar symptoms) I should be worried about? Thanks for the time.
 
if your roots are white its not root rot , u will know if u have root rot your ph will go up alot and the slime is everywhere , also spots on your leaves can be to do with ph fluctuating. i had root rot and my ph when from 6.4 rite upto 8.9 then i got the spots on the leaves , best products would be either hydrogen pyroxide %3 from your chemist or hygrozyme.
